Oktober 2017 11:37:15 CEST Philipp Hörist wrote: > Hi, > > I dont read anything in the XEP about Real JIDs. > The XEP allows to block MUC Jids perfectly fine like > > user@domain/resource > ex. [email protected]/testuser > > And if i block such a JID, i think the server will block all presence from > that.
I missed that you were blocking participant JIDs. > Now i know there is no good way of blocking MUC participants, the best > thing you can do is a kind of "ignore" functionality with privacy lists. > > But i think a note in the XEP is needed that MUC Jids should not be added, > and if, that its clear this is only a one way blocking, which can lead to > privacy leaks. Adding a note doesn’t harm. That it blocks presence is unfortunate, I had my share of mishaps because I forgot that a person I /ignore-ed was in some IRC channel … I could imagine a MUC server supporting XEP-0191 directly and allowing you to block participants in some sensible way. kind regards, Jonas
